How Life Works Here
Granville Street is located in Westmorland and Furness, near Barrow-in-Furness. Crime is around average for the area, with 112 incidents in the past year. The most commonly reported category is violence and sexual offences. Violent offences account for 53% of reported crimes.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Public transport is accessible, with rail stops within reach. The nearest is about 465m away. The median property price is £75,000, with a slight decline of 7% over five years. Based on 5 transactions recorded since 2014. There are 9 schools within 2 km, 8 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. The nearest school is just 278m away. The profile suggests appeal to both first-time buyers and families. Overall, this street scores 50 out of 100 for liveability, placing it in the top 9% within its district.
